I got the 2 Lucars connected to the switch, put the ignition in position 2, tested thediff lockwithand saw the CDL light come on. The truck wasmoved to park in the street where I was going to take a picture of the CDL light, only to find the light doesn't turn on now. I've tried locking it before turning the iginition on and after and it just won't come on anymore. I didn't try to swap the connections because it is getting dark, but I'm curious if they go on certain sides of the switch. The RAVE says to just "Connect Lucars to switch", so I assume it doesn't matter. Is there a fuse for this light? When starting it appears all the dash lights are turning on for the system check, except the CDL of course.

I couldn't wait until the morning, so after getting home I took another look at the switch. Right, the switch works on a ground so that's why it shouldn't matter about where the wires connect (both are black). I think the connections on the switch were a little more corroded than I thought, even though a wire brush was used to clean the terminals. I just slid the connectors up and down a few times and checked the CDL again. It seems works just fine now.

Well it appears my switch is totally dead now and the dash CDL light isn't coming on at all. [:@] I tested it today and no light. I've gone under again and used a wire brush and re-connected multiple times but nothing is happening. Is this a part I'm likely to get out of another t-case, or are there specific part numbers to order new? I would need the differential warning lamp switch & threaded spacer. This is EXACTLY what happened to mine, it worked when initially installed, it then was intermittent, so I took it out to clean it up and it fell apart basically. So in the end had to get a new one.
It just dies from just 7 years of no use.
Switch part number PRC2911 , you say you need the washer aswell? you have already got one of these ?
I do believe it is VERY similar to reverse light switches fitted on the Disco and "Other" cars, but cannot confirm that 100%
